I have very thick slightly curly/wavy and coarse hair. Styling devices for me, have to have a high heat, otherwise they don't do anything for my hair. I tried the Perfector, ordered and returned it, it did not get hot enough. That is always a concern for me, will it get hot enough and will it be able to style my thick head of hair.

I have learned that if a heated styling device does not have a heat setting and tell you what the temp is, I won't take a chance on buying it. I have to have a heat setting of 400 or 425, otherwise it is a waste of my time and won't style my hair.

I like the idea of a heated styling brush, and hope that the ladies that purchase this new T3 will provide reviews when they've had a chance to try it. It looks interesting, I may purchase it later on if the initial reviews are good.
